Hans-Dietrich Genscher was a prominent German politician, known for his long tenure as a minister and for his central role in the foreign policy of the Federal Republic of Germany. A member of the FDP, he served as Minister of the Interior (1969–1974) and then as Foreign Minister and Vice-Chancellor from 1974 to 1992, becoming the longest-serving holder of those posts and serving under two different chancellors.
Regarded as a proponent of realpolitik and nicknamed the “master of diplomacy,” Genscher played a decisive role in removing barriers to German reunification and is widely considered one of the principal architects of that process. In 1991 he presided over the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e (OSCE) and was actively engaged in international diplomacy during the dissolution of Yugoslavia, influencing the recognition of new republics.
After leaving government, he worked as a lawyer, international consultant and president of the German Council on Foreign Relations, and participated in cultural and historical memory initiatives. He published memoirs, collections of speeches and essays on foreign and European policy, establishing a lasting legacy in German and European diplomacy.
